
Hedge Planting Surrey Hills Society
The Surrey Hills Society were awarded a grant of £2944 to plant 250m of native broad leaf hedge plants along a footpath. The aims for this project were to increase connectivity, habitats, and biodiversity. The volunteers planting the hedging will learn more about hedges and their benefits but also improve their mental well being by being outside.
